1.5-12 kW High-Purity PFA Inline Chemical Heater For Process Chemistries

Overview

In-Line heaters provide ultra-high purity heating to meet the many heating applications, from Deionized Water (DIW) to Hydrofluoric Acid (HF) or Potassium Hydroxide (KOH), all while maintaining performance and quality. The heaters are available in PVDF or Teflon housings to provide flexibility and to ensure compatibility. We provides a low-watt density design, efficient heating, rapid response, and excellent temperature control, with high power output in a compact housing. White Knight also provides in-line heating using heat exchangers, the White Knight Vesper Series. These are available as exchangers only (no heating element) and as an all-in one Heater and Exchanger. These are perfect for temperature trimming, heating near ambient, or processes with an exothermic reaction.

PFA in-line heater are desinged for hydrofluoric acid (HF), potassium hydroxide (KOH), and other chemistry compatible with PFA.

These PFA heaters push widely accepted high-purity materials to operating extremes while maximizing performance and reliability.

Features

  • No O-Ring seals
  • All wetted surfaces are high purity PFA
  • PTFE housing for double containment
  • Maximized watt density for performance
  • Light weight construction
  • Small foot print enabled by unique design
  • Zero maintenance required
  • PFA fluid path, wide chemistry compatibility
  • High temperature capability 200°C+

Specifications

Heater
PFA In-line Chemical Heater
Wattages
1.5-12 kW
Process Chemistries
Dilute Hydrofluoric acids (DHF),
Buffered Hydrofluoric acids (BHF),
Buffered Oxide etch (BOE),
Alkaline Chemicals (TMAH, KOH, NAOH),
Fluorinated Solvents,
Hydrofluoric Acid,
Glycol, and much more.
Max Operating Temperature
180°C (consult factory
for higher temperatures)
Max Pressure
40 psi at 180°C
Voltages
200-400VAC,
single or 3 phase
model dependent

Industries

  • Semiconductor Fabrication
  • Solar Cell Manufacturing
  • Flat-Panel Display, LEDs & Electronics
  • Chemicals Manufacturing
  • Industrial Manufacturing
